Future TECHNICAL APPROACH
Technologies Used:
1. Data Collection and Preprocessing
- Technology: Data integration from various sources.
- Languages: Python (Pandas, NumPy).
2.Weather Data Integration
- Technology: Real-time weather data processing.
- Languages: Python (APIs - NOAA, OpenWeatherMap).
3.AIS Data Handling
- Technology: Ship tracking and historical data analysis.
- Languages: Python (API - MarineTraffic), SQL.
4.Route Optimization Model
- Technology: Machine learning for predictive routing.
- Languages: Python (TensorFlow, Keras, Scikit-learn).
5.Bathymetric Analysis
- Technology: Seafloor mapping and depth analysis.
- Languages: Python (GIS libraries), C++ (if needed for performance).
6.Fuel Consumption Prediction
- Technology: Regression models for fuel efficiency.
- Languages: Python (Scikit-learn, Pandas).
7.User Interface Development
- Technology: Interactive dashboard for route visualization.
- Languages: Python (Dash, Flask), JavaScript (D3.js).
8.Deployment and Scalability
- Technology: Cloud-based deployment for real-time updates.
- Languages: Python (Django, Flask), Cloud services (AWS, Azure).
